At Kirbha Clinic, skin cancer removal is performed by Mr Bhagwat Mathur. Skin cancers, including basal cell carcinoma (BCC), squamous cell carcinoma (SCC), and melanoma, can be serious conditions that require timely assessment and precise management.

  • BCC is the most common skin cancer, often appearing as small, pearly bumps or patches that may bleed or ulcerate. BCC can be superficial, nodular, cystic, pigmented, infiltrative or cicatricial in presentation.
  • SCC typically develops as firm, scaly, or crusted lesions, sometimes on sun-exposed areas, with potential for spread and deeper tissue involvement if left untreated.
  • Melanoma is the most serious form, often presenting as dark or irregularly shaped moles or patches, and requires early, specialist intervention. In some cases, melanoma can develop from existing moles or present as new pigmented lesions (as in cases of lentigo or in situ melanoma). This is why any mole that changes in size, shape, colour, or sensation should be assessed promptly by an experienced consultant surgeon.

Although the prospect of skin cancer can be worrying, early detection and expert surgical removal significantly improves outcomes. Procedures are performed under local anaesthetic or with sedation, ensuring minimal discomfort. Mild soreness, redness, or swelling is normal during healing and can be managed with simple pain relief. Mr Mathur prioritises patient comfort and gentle tissue handling.

Recovery varies depending on lesion size and complexity. Small excisions may heal in 1-2 weeks, while larger procedures requiring grafts or flaps may take 2-4 weeks. Follow-up appointments ensure optimal healing and monitoring.

Minor swelling, bruising, and scarring are common. Serious complications are infrequent. Detailed aftercare instructions help minimise risks and support recovery.

Keep the area clean and dry, follow dressing instructions, and avoid trauma to the site. Mr Mathur provides personalised aftercare guidance and is available for follow-up if concerns arise.

While removal eliminates the treated lesion, incomplete excision and recurrence can happen and new skin cancers can develop elsewhere. Regular skin checks and early assessment of new skin lesions are essential.
